When do Austrians celebrate Christmas?

Traditionally, Christmas celebrations in Austria last for four weeks. Families begin to celebrate and festivals are held four weeks before December 24th and continue until Christmas day.


How do they celebrate Christmas in Uruguay?

The days leading up to Christmas in Uruguay are spent decorating the tree. Families celebrate by having Christmas eve dinner together. Papa Noel delivers toys to the girls and boys at midnight.
